Firmus Technologies builds immersion-cooled artificial intelligence factories that run large GPU fleets on renewable power. Founded in 2021 in Singapore, it develops both the data centre design and the cloud service on top. Its Project Southgate campuses in Australia are among the region's largest planned artificial intelligence sites.

ROLE SUMMARY  

Firmus Technologies is seeking a Senior AI Infrastructure Engineer, Observability, to join our Engineering and Technology team. You will establishhow we measure, validateand communicate the health of GPU infrastructure used for customer and internal workloads. You will define trusted health signals and service-readiness criteria, and turn them into reusable dashboards, alerts, queries, diagnostic checksand operational guidance. Your work will help commissioning, infrastructure and operations teams bring capacity online safely, identifydegradation early and recover from failures quickly. You will also make knowledge self-service by publishing clear reference implementations, runbooksand AI-ready operational knowledge that other teams can use and extend. 

KEYRESPONSIBILITIES  

  • The Health Standard  

    Define GPU and host health criteria for customer and internal workloads, and the service-readiness gates that repair and capacity workflows depend on. Cover what stops or corrupts AI jobs: GPUs falling off the bus, XID events, ECC and memory faults, NVLink/NVSwitch degradation, thermal and power capping, NCCL and collective failures, silent data corruption, and stragglers running below fleet baseline. 

  • Reference Implementations  

    Publish golden dashboards, alerts, PromQL/LogQL queries and health checks that other teams adopt and extend. Your output is the standard and the examples. The alerts must be specific, low-noise, and with a clear next action. 

     

  • Diagnostics with Real Pass/Fail Criteria  

    DCGM checks, NCCL and bandwidth tests, stress and burn-in, and validation jobs that confirm a server matches expected performance. Others must be able to run them without you. 

  • Fault Isolation  

    Separate a bad GPU from a cooling, host, network or power-limit problem using host and BMC/management-interface telemetry together, including when the same signature appears across many servers. A clean management view means nothing if the host is throwing faults. 

     

  • Detection of the Failures that Don't Crash  

Rising correctable ECC counts, NVLink retries, thermal slowdown, XID patterns, wrong results with no error. Keep the knowledge current: what each signal means, what to do next on the machine, and where the operation team must make the final decision. 

  • Partnership and Escalation

    Work with commissioning on bring-up and acceptance, operations on break-fix, infrastructure on what healthy hardware looks like, and the telemetry owners on making your signals production-grade. Run technical sessions with customer teams on the telemetry they need. Join GPU and host incidents, including debugging on the server and convert every finding into a reusable check, alert or runbook. Give engineering leadership a straight read on fleet health and risk. 

S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E 

  • Bachelor's degree in computer science or a related technical field, or equivalent practical experience. 
  • 7+ years in GPU, HPC, AI infrastructure or closely related large-scale systems engineering environments, including ownership of health monitoring or diagnostics used by customers or internal teams. 
  • Experience with production GPU fault diagnosis. You'vefound genuine faults through XID events, ECC/memory errors, NVLinkissues, power or thermal limits and caught at least one before the job died. 
  • Strong Linux and server fundamentals. You can debug on the machine and reason across GPU, CPU, memory, PCIe, power and cooling. You automate in Python or similar. 
  • Hands-on with GPU diagnostics and validation such as DCGM, NCCL/collective tests, stress testing and you've turned them into checks other people run. 
  • Experience analysing infrastructure telemetry, building trusted dashboards and alerts. Savvy with PromQL, LogQL, Grafana or comparable tooling. Able to follow an unexpected signal until thereis a cause and can turn that into an alert or check others will trust. 
  • Uses AI tools as a normal part of analysis and build work. Can structure health knowledge and build AI skills so operation team withAI assistants can use iteffectively to recover from incidents. 
  • Willing to take part in the incident-response on-call rotation. 
  • Willing to travel overseas occasionally when the role requires it. 
  • Clear and effective written and verbal communication in English. 

Highly Desirable Experiences

  • Production experience on large GPU systems with tight GPU-to-GPU interconnect. 
  • Multiple sites or GPU generations, especially preparing health monitoring before a new GPU class entered production. 
  • Background at an AI cloud, GPU cloud or HPC centre running customer workloads. 
  • Experience working with data or ML engineers on GPU/host failure prediction from health signals. 
  • Built a structured operational knowledge so AI assistants can use it effectively during incident recovery.
